Summary
Traffic control; pedestrians; definition of motor vehicle; exclude power-driven mobility devices under certain circumstances, and include disabled individuals using wheelchairs or other mobility devices in definition of pedestrian. Amends secs. 33 & 39 of 1949 PA 300 (MCL 257.33 & 257.39) & adds sec. 43c. TIE BAR WITH: HB 5834'18
